Minutes from the World Language Task Force
December 6, 2007
About 20 members of the Elementary World Languages Committee met on December 6, 2007, in the DeWitt Blank Board Room. Co-chairs, Dr. Bucci, Assistant Superintendent for Elementary Education and CeCe Kelly, World Languages Chairperson for the district facilitated the meeting. Dr. Bucci welcomed the members to the second meeting of the committee and reviewed the agenda for the evening.
CeCe Kelly described our current world languages program and the proposed changes for 2008-09. In the current program, students are introduced to French, German, and Spanish during one quarter in the sixth grade. In 7 th grade, students choose one of those three languages to explore for another quarter. In the 8 th grade, students may take a full year of French, German, or Spanish.
The program is being expanded in 2008-09 in several ways. Students in the 6 th grade will have a semester course called Introduction to World Languages. In that course students will learn about the origins of language with an introduction to Latin and Greek. They will explore French, German, Spanish and Russian. During 7 th and 8 th grade students will be able to choose from French, German or Spanish to pursue for two full years of study. They will then be well-positioned to deepen and/or expand their world language learning at the high school. Russian begins in 9 th grade.
Members then separated into four subcommittees to continue their study. Each sub-committee will seek answers to one of the following questions:
- What level of support exists in our community for teaching World Languages at the elementary level?
- What are the advantages and disadvantages of each type of World Language Program?
- Which language(s) should be taught at the elementary level and why?
- What are the educational benefits to children who study a World Language at the elementary level?
Dr. Bucci and/or CeCe Kelly will attend each of the sub-committee meetings. They will be held at the administration building. Dates and times will be posted soon. The larger committee will reconvene to receive sub-committee reports on Thursday, February 21, 2008, at 7:00 PM in the DeWitt Blank Board Room.
